inverse
—
adjective
(= reverse)
reversed (turned backward) in order or nature or effect
—
adjective
opposite in nature or effect or relation to another quantity
a term is in inverse proportion to another term if it increases (or decreases) as the other decreases (or increases)
—
noun
something inverted in sequence or character or effect
when the direct approach failed he tried the inverse
telecine
noun
—
(film) The process of transferring motion picture film into electronic form.
—
A machine used to carry out this process.
telecine
verb
—
To transfer (motion picture film) into electronic form.
